/*
DataEast/Sega Version 1 and 2
Main CPU: 6808 @ 4MHz
Audio CPU: 68B09E @ 8MHz (internally divided by 4)
Audio: YM2151 @ 3.58MHz, MSM5205 @ 384kHz
*/

// Data East CPU board is similar to Williams System 11, but without the generic audio board.
// For now, we'll presume the timings are the same.
// 6808 CPU's input clock is 4MHz
// but because it has an internal /4 divider, its E clock runs at 1/4 that frequency
#define E_CLOCK (XTAL_4MHz/4)
// Length of time in cycles between IRQs on the main 6808 CPU
// This length is determined by the settings of the W14 and W15 jumpers
// It can be 0x300, 0x380, 0x700 or 0x780 cycles long.
// IRQ length is always 32 cycles
#define S11_IRQ_CYCLES 0x380
